Literature Reference: 瀚指广大,如瀚海;鏞指大钟,象征庄严与权威。—— 《说文解字》 Han refers to vastness, like the boundless sea; Yong refers to a large bell, symbolizing solemnity and authority. Source from 'Shuowen Jiezi'.
瀚: Vast and expansive, it often signifies erudition, profound knowledge, and a broad-minded spirit in names. It aids in learning and fostering friendships.
鏞: Similar to "镛". An obscure character, use with caution.
Meaning: Han symbolizes boundlessness, while Yong represents solemnity and authority, implying a broad mind and majestic demeanor.
